Common Plumbing Issues and Their Solutions
Homeowners in Milford Mill frequently encounter several types of plumbing challenges. These can include, but are not limited to:
- Leaky Faucets and Toilets: These are often caused by worn-out washers, seals, or cartridges. Professionals typically replace these faulty components to ensure a watertight seal.
- Clogged Drains: Whether in kitchens, bathrooms, or main sewer lines, clogs can result from grease, hair, soap scum, or foreign objects. Plumbers use methods like drain snaking, hydro-jetting, or enzymatic cleaners to clear blockages.
- Running Toilets: This common problem is usually due to a faulty flapper valve, fill valve, or a chain that has become dislodged or stretched. Adjustments or replacement of these parts are standard procedures.
- Water Heater Issues: From insufficient hot water to strange noises or leaks, water heater problems require expert diagnosis of heating elements, thermostats, valves, or sediment buildup.
- Pipe Leaks and Bursts: More serious issues like leaks in exposed pipes or full pipe bursts, especially during colder weather, demand immediate professional intervention to prevent extensive water damage. Repairs may involve pipe patching, section replacement, or even a full repiping depending on the extent of the damage and the age of the plumbing system.
- Sewer Line Problems: Tree root intrusion, blockages, or collapsed sewer lines are critical issues addressed by specialized plumbers using advanced diagnostic tools like sewer cameras and trenchless repair methods.

Materials and Methods Commonly Used
Modern plumbing repair services employ a range of materials and techniques to ensure long-lasting solutions. Common materials include copper, PEX (cross-linked polyethylene), and PVC piping. Repair methods can vary from traditional soldering and compression fittings to advanced trenchless pipe repair technologies, especially for sewer line issues, minimizing disruption to your property. For drains, professionals utilize a variety of augers, plungers, and high-pressure water jetters. Water heaters might be repaired by servicemen replacing thermostats, heating elements, or Anode rods, or through complete unit replacement when necessary.

Q1: What is a typical timeline for plumbing repairs in Milford Mill homes, especially for older properties?
A1: For minor repairs like a leaky faucet or running toilet, a plumber can often complete the work within an hour or two. However, for more complex issues such as drain clogs, water heater malfunctions, or significant pipe leaks, the timeline can extend to several hours or even a full day, depending on the diagnosis and the extent of the repair. Older homes in Milford Mill might sometimes require more time due to older materials or less accessible pipes, necessitating careful assessment by the technician.
Q2: Are there any specific plumbing concerns related to the climate or common housing styles in Milford Mill, Maryland?
A2: Yes, Milford Mill experiences distinct seasons. During colder months, freezing temperatures can pose a risk of pipes bursting, especially in less insulated areas. Homeowners should be mindful of exposed pipes. In older homes, which are prevalent in some Milford Mill neighborhoods, issues like corroded pipes or outdated components are more common than in newer constructions. The local water quality can also sometimes contribute to sediment buildup in water heaters and pipes over time.
